WebJan 14, 2024 · 1. Know the difference between molecular and ionic compounds. The first step in writing a net ionic equation is identifying the ionic compounds of the reaction. Ionic compounds are those that will ionize in an aqueous solution and have a charge. [2] Molecular compounds are compounds that never have a charge. WebJul 24, 2024 · NH 4+ is always a soluble ion, CO32- are only soluble with Group I metals, aluminum, and ammonium. Equation: Ca 2+ (aq) + 2Cl - (aq) + CO32- (aq) + 2NH 4+ (aq) -------> CaCO3 (s) + 2NH 4+ (aq) + 2Cl - (aq) Net ionic equation means that same ions located in both left and right of chemical equation get cancelled out.
